Asymptotic decoupling and weak Gibbs measures for finite alphabet shift spaces
2020
Abstract
For the spaceXin a large class of finite alphabet shift spaces (lattice models) and the class of functionsfwith bounded total oscillations, we prove that each equilibrium measure nu atf=phi is a weak Gibbs measures for phi-P(phi). In addition, the empirical measures satisfy a full large deviations principle for (X,nu).
